Tolerance to self antigens is established in two ways: first in the thymus through the deletion of thymocytes expressing selfâreactive T cell receptors; and second, in the periphery through multiple mechanisms involving deletion, anergy, and suppression.

Functional analysis is the study of functions defined on certain abstract sets; these sets may vary greatly in their structure and the nature of their elements but they have in common the property that it is possible to define in them the notions of convergence, limit and so on: in other words, they are topological spaces.
